A Winged Victory for the Sullen is the soaring project by the Americans Adam Wiltzie and Dustin O’Halloran. What began as a temporary collaboration in 2007 has evolved into an unbreakable bond, with four albums and countless compositions for film and theatre, including the BAFTA-winning Lion and Iris. Their cinematic ambient builds on lengthy crescendos, and plays with our expectations. They give their music all the time it needs to unfurl. Wiltzie, now living in Brussels, adds: “I’ve always had a great love of instrumental music that uses both acoustic keyboard instruments and lots of electronics.” Names such as Arvo Pärt, Brian Eno and Gavin Bryars are both points of reference and points of arrival to steer clear of.
